Headteacher blog Week Beginning 30th March

Date: 3rd Apr 2015 @ 5:05pm

This week seemed like a race against time to cram everything in before the end of term.

In nearly all classes, most children were working hard to finish their topic books. Several children were very proud to share their work with me.

Even though it was the last week and we only had 4 days, we still found time to invite in someone to lead a workshop on Fairness and Fairtrade around the world using huge floor maps that filled the hall floor. It was a popular workshop with the children.

With it being Easter, we had to have an Easter Bonnet parade. Everyone had made such an effort and the children looked wonderful. All the Infants enjoyed getting together and showing off their hats whilst singing easter songs. I pulled the short straw and had to judge the winners from each class. It was a perfect way to end the Spring Term.

It has been such a busy term and everyone deserves a well earned rest. However, two weeks is a long time and I hope the children manage to keep up with learning their tables and reading books so they hit the ground running in the Summer.
